    I’m not staff, but I can’t see any ads on your site or your post, however this doesn’t mean they’re not there.

    All free WordPress.com blogs are likely to get ads, eventually – it’s how the site pays for the blog being free. The only way to get rid of them, I’m afraid, is to upgrade to a paid account (the starting price for the lowest one isn’t that high) and included in that is the no-ads upgrade. I’m not sure that you can choose what sort of ads are displayed, though.

    Most people aren’t aware of ads on their blogs or sites here because they tend not to show to the blog’s owner when logged in. They show when the cache has been cleared and the person is logged out. Maybe that’s how you suddenly were aware of them on your blog.

  • We run ads on free sites to keep them free: https://wordpress.com/support/no-ads/

    If you see an offensive ad, please do report it via the “Report This Ad” link below the ad, or by submitting the form at https://wordpress.com/support/about-these-ads/

    To remove ads, simply purchase any paid plan: https://wordpress.com/pricing/
